Romanian Defense Minister Angel Tilvar has confirmed that the wreckage of an aircraft, probably a Russian kamikaze drone, was found on Romanian territory.
Source. This was reported by Antena 3 CNN.
Recently, Russia has been regularly attacking the Ukrainian ports of Reni and Izmail on the Danube, which are located near the border of Ukraine and Romania. Tilvar said that "enhanced vigilance measures" will be taken in this regard.
This will include the establishment of new observation points, as well as the introduction of "technical solutions" to protect Romanian territory. At the same time, Tilvar emphasized that attacks on Ukrainian ports do not pose a threat to Romania.
Earlier, Ukraine reported the arrival of a kamikaze drone in Romania, but the Romanian Defense Ministry said that the Russian drones did not pose a direct military threat to the country.
Ukraine's Foreign Minister Dmytro Kuleba said that it was "pointless" to deny that the attack drone had crashed on Romanian territory, as there was photographic evidence.
At the same time, the Romanian president said that no drones had fallen on the territory of his country.
